Fresno County home invasion leaves 2 elderly residents injured

FRESNO, Calif.

The Fresno County Sheriff's Department said five suspects forcibly entered an elderly couple's home, on Kings Canyon near Thompson, demanding drugs. They said all five suspects were armed with hand guns and were wearing black ski masks and black clothing with "DEA" logos.

The Sheriff's Office said the five suspects remained in the home for two hours while searching for drugs. They said during the search, the couple in their 60's were assaulted by the suspects.

Authorities said, after the suspects found out there were no drugs at the home, they fled the scene.

The couple was taken to the hospital following the incident. A third person in the home was not injured. The Fresno County Sheriff's Office said the victims were not involved in drug trafficking.

So far no arrests have been made. Authorities are still looking for the suspects.
